Aspects Affecting Tolerance Levels

While various aspects can influence tolerance degrees in aluminum foundry products, crucial elements include the kind of alloy utilized, the casting process used, and the style specifications of the component. Various aluminum alloys possess distinct properties that can affect shrinking prices, thermal development, and mechanical stamina, ultimately influencing resistances. On top of that, the casting procedure-- whether sand casting, pass away casting, or financial investment casting-- figures out how closely a completed component can follow defined measurements. Each technique has fundamental attributes that impact the accuracy of the final product. The design specs, including geometric intricacy and feature sizes, play a vital function in developing acceptable tolerances. Elements with detailed functions may need tighter tolerances official statement due to manufacturing limitations. Comprehending these factors makes it possible for suppliers to handle and anticipate tolerance degrees successfully, making certain that products meet efficiency demands and quality standards.

Gauging Tolerances Accurately

Accurate measurement of tolerances in aluminum foundry items is vital for ensuring that components satisfy their intended specifications - aluminum casting. To attain this, suppliers need to utilize precise dimension techniques and tools. Typical approaches include the usage of calipers, micrometers, and coordinate measuring devices (CMMs), each offering varying degrees of accuracy


It is additionally critical to develop a standardized dimension procedure, guaranteeing consistency throughout various operators and devices. This might include regular calibration of gauging instruments to maintain precision over time.

Furthermore, producers should think about environmental elements, such as temperature and moisture, which can affect dimension outcomes. Applying a robust quality assurance system that includes routine audits of measurement methods can even more improve precision. By prioritizing accurate measurement of resistances, manufacturers can reduce mistakes and ensure that aluminum components fulfill the required specs, inevitably causing enhanced production efficiency and product dependability.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Do Tolerances Influence Price in Aluminum Casting Projects?

Resistances considerably influence cost in aluminum casting projects by determining the precision called for during production. Stricter resistances commonly cause link raised machining, greater scrap prices, and prolonged production times, inevitably driving up overall task costs.

What Is the Common Tolerance Range for Aluminum Elements?

The conventional tolerance array for aluminum components typically differs from ± 0.005 inches to ± 0.020 inches, depending on the particular application and element size, making sure ample fit and function in numerous making procedures.

Can Tolerances Be Modified After Production Starts?



Tolerances can be modified after production starts, however it normally requires extra processes, changes, or retooling. This can result in boosted expenses and possible hold-ups, making it important to develop exact tolerances before beginning manufacturing.
